India recorded the highest net shutdowns globally in 1H 2022

According to a new report, India accounted for up to 85% of internet shutdowns in the first six months of 2022 out of 10 countries where internet outages and restrictions were recorded.

A report released by Internet watchdog NetBlocks and VPN service Surfshark said Asia is the most censored continent.

In India, Jammu and Kashmir saw maximum shutdowns, although it was rampant in other parts of the country as well. On June 17, a significant disruption of fixed and mobile internet connectivity was reported in Bihar, according to Netblocks. The incidents occurred due to government-imposed telecom restrictions in the state to counter protests against the Agnipath recruitment scheme, NetBlocks added.

The report also showed that of the 10 countries where shutdowns were recorded, the number of cases in the first half of this year fell by 14% – from 84 in H1 2021 to 72 in H1 2022.
